What Is a Decentralized Vault Portfolio?

For those stepping into the world of cryptocurrency, the array of tools and concepts can seem daunting. However, understanding what is a Decentralized Vault Portfolio (DVP) offers an accessible entry point to engage with digital assets securely, making it ideal for new users and the broader crypto community. Built on the Cardano blockchain, platforms like PBG.io are leading the way in introducing DVPs to bring transparency, control, and efficiency to asset management. A DVP is essentially a tokenized fund managed entirely by smart contracts, meaning there are no intermediaries like banks or traditional financial institutions involved. This decentralized approach ensures that users have direct oversight of their assets, fostering trust and autonomy in a way that traditional finance often cannot.

To clarify what is a Decentralized Vault Portfolio, let’s explore its mechanics, as detailed on PBG.io’s DVP page. A DVP allows users to mint tokens that represent a share of a diversified portfolio of digital assets. These portfolios can include a mix of cryptocurrencies and tokenized real-world assets, providing diversification without the complexity of managing multiple investments individually. The process is straightforward: users deposit assets like Cardano’s native token, ADA, and receive DVP tokens in return. These tokens can later be burned to withdraw a proportional share of the portfolio’s assets. Unlike traditional funds, understanding what is a Decentralized Vault Portfolio reveals its non-custodial nature, meaning users retain full control over their assets at all times. This model significantly reduces risks associated with third-party management, such as mismanagement or security breaches.

Why Cardano Powers a Secure DVP Experience

The Cardano blockchain, detailed at cardano.org, provides a robust foundation for DVPs due to its high decentralization, security, and scalability. Cardano’s proof-of-stake consensus mechanism ensures energy efficiency, making it a sustainable choice for decentralized applications. Additionally, Cardano’s peer-reviewed approach to development guarantees a reliable and scalable platform, which is crucial for managing DVPs effectively.
